From 1887 to Today: A Living Legend
The story begins in 1887, when Hotel Kämp first welcomed guests and quickly became known as Helsinki's iconic heart. After a major renovation, the doors reopened in 1999, returning the building to its prominent place in the city center. Now the hotel is renewing once again, with the work being carried out in phases and the fully renewed property expected to be ready in 2026. Throughout the renewal, the hotel remains open, so the address on Pohjoisesplanadi keeps its familiar hum even as the interiors evolve.
Drinks, Dining and the New Kämp Spa
Inside, the spaces described by the hotel reflect a blend of heritage and refresh. The iconic Kämp Bar has been restored to full glory and serves as a cocktail destination within the building. Adjacent to it, restaurant À La Kämp offers an elegant setting for meals, while the new Kämp Spa introduces a wellness retreat right at the heart of the property.
